CRIME NEWS
- ➤ Devon Edwards, a 22-year-old man, was arrested Friday for his alleged role in a March 29 shooting outside Bowlero Bethesda on Westbard Ave—police said he faces charges of first-degree assault, use of a firearm in a felony, reckless endangerment and conspiracy to commit malicious destruction of property while two individuals sustained minor injuries from broken glass. GOVERNMENT NEWS
- ➤ Montgomery County Public Libraries will release a free mobile app Friday that lets residents browse the library catalog, manage their accounts, scan item barcodes, and access digital content—available from both the Apple Store and Google Play. WUSA9
- ➤ WMATA and Gov. Wes Moore revealed plans Tuesday morning to change North Bethesda Metro station — the plan adds a new north end entrance, two public plazas, and a life sciences institute in partnership with the University of Maryland by developer Hines — to improve transit access and boost local growth. REAL ESTATE NEWS
- ➤ Local officials and partners announced a $33m project to build a new Institute for Health Computing with housing and retail on 14 acres near North Bethesda Metro Station along Rockville Pike. Developer Hines said ground will break in just over two years—Governor Moore budgeted $33m in state funds to boost the local economy. WJLA
SPORTS NEWS
- ➤ Over the weekend, Montgomery County students with First Tee of Greater Washington, D.C. went inside the ropes at the Senior PGA Championship held at Congressional Country Club in Bethesda — they joined players over 50 competing in the event. Montgomery Community Media
